Not really a hoax bc I have that CD but another weird case.

Metal Archives

No band name, no album name, no songs titles, no lyrics, no name of the involved musician(s).

The label on the CD is white. There is no booklet just a card with a statement on it. It's a long statement about how the Black Metal scene and everything about Black Metal sucks and that the person who did that CD doesn't want to be a part of the scene.

The only hint is that the songs have been recorded at "Wäldliche Tonschmiede" (WT) in 2005.
WT is long defunct as a studio and label.
